Inquiry lessons are characterized by:
Encouraging students to ask questions and allowing them to test out ideas
According to Piaget's theory, how can discoveries be maximized in students?
By personally manipulating materials and data
What is the goal of the constructivist inquiry model in teaching science?
To involve students in the discovery of relationships among observed phenomena
What is the role of a teacher in the pure discovery approach?
Provide students with materials and give them time to manipulate the material
What is the primary focus of inquiry in seeking knowledge, information, or truth?
Questioning
